Check for fire dangers


As you check your shutoffs, give its environments an once over. Check the location for fire risks, especially if you make use of a gas-powered hot water heater.
First, look for flammable products like fuel, gas storage tanks, and also other heat-generating devices. Next, look for bits of paper as well as wood, including garbage. Do not throw away your trash near your water heater devices.
You would certainly do well to keep any garments far from your water heater. Should a fire begin, these materials will promote its spread. That claimed, your washing line should not be close to your hot water heater.

Constantly maintain appropriate ventilation


If your hot water heater isn't effectively aired vent, it'll lead fumes right into your residence. This could set off breathing issues and also provide you cough or an allergy.
A good vent must deal with up or have a vertical slant, leading the smoke far from the house. If your vent does not follow this style, it may be a setup error.
You require a plumber's assistance to repair bad hot water heater air flow.

Examine your Stress and also Temperature Level Shutoffs


Your hot water heater's temperature level and also pressure valves manage the temperature level and also stress within the hot water heater storage tank. These valves will avoid an explosion if your tank gets too hot or if the stress goes beyond risk-free degrees.
Regrettably, these security devices give no warning when they spoil. You can confirm your valve's effectiveness by holding on to the valve's lever. If it remains in good condition, water ought to spurt. If no water flows out or a drip is released, hurry and also obtain your valves taken care of.

  • Constantly pre-programmed the optimum temperature level


    Hot water burns in the house prevail. You can stop accidents, save power as well as respect the environment simply by presetting your water heater's optimum temperature level. One of the most hassle-free hot water temperature is 120F. Water at this temperature is risk-free for grownups, kids, and also the elderly.

    Tips to Increase the Lifespan of your Water Heater


    Turn OFF the geyser when not in use


    Turn the geyser off when you are done using it. It will help decrease power consumption, extend lifespan, and save money on water heater repair. The water does not turn cold, even after switching the geyser off, as the storage tank holds the temperature of the water for 4-5 hours.


    Proper Installation


    Proper space should be left around the water heater. It should not feel crowded, and giving room to breathe increases airflow and reduces the risk of fires. This gives you optimal space for completing routine system maintenance checks without difficulty. Nothing should be kept near or under the geyser. The geyser should be installed away from wet areas, like the bathtub, shower, or toilet.


    Insulate your Water Heater


    Insulation should be installed around the pipes and the water heater to make it more energy efficient and to increase the water temperature by 2-4 degrees. During the summertime, this keeps the pipes from sweating or forming condensation. It can also protect your cold water pipes from freezing and potentially bursting during cooler months. Insulation may cut heat loss by as much as 45% and your expenditures for overheating the water.


    Replace the Sacrificial Anode


    Water heaters are equipped with a sacrificial anode to prevent corrosion by hard water. The anode rod protects the tank from rusting on the inside and should be checked yearly. Without a rod or a properly functioning anode rod, the hot water quickly corrodes inside the tank. It can last anywhere from five to ten years. However, the amount of water you use and the hardness of your water determines its need for replacement.


    Install a Water Softener


    f you live in an area where the mineral content is high in the water systems, then installing a water softener might help expand the lifespan of your water heater. When an area has high mineral content (calcium and magnesium) in the water, it’s known as hard water. Hard water leaves deposits to form at the bottom of the water heater, which causes them to have problems much sooner than expected. To prevent this from happening, install a water softener that filters out the minerals that make the water hard, allowing only soft water to flow through the pipes.


    Lower the Temperature


    Lowering the temperature of your geyser will help you save electricity, increase its life, and the geyser will have to work less. Maintaining a temperature of 120 degrees Fahrenheit to eradicate the vast majority of pathogens is a good thumb rule. The hotter your hot water supply is, the more energy it will consume.
